    What is Oncor Energy Outage?

    An Oncor energy outage refers to any interruption in the electricity supply provided by Oncor Electric Delivery Company. These outages can range from brief moments to extended periods, depending on the cause and severity. Oncor serves more than 4 million customers across 126 counties in Texas, making its operations critical for the state's energy infrastructure.

    Common causes of Oncor energy outages include severe weather conditions, equipment failures, and maintenance activities. Understanding these causes is the first step in preparing for potential disruptions. By staying informed, customers can take proactive measures to safeguard their homes and businesses.

    Causes of Oncor Energy Outages

    Oncor energy outages can stem from various factors, both natural and human-made. Below are some of the primary causes:

    • Severe Weather: Storms, hurricanes, and extreme temperatures can damage power lines and transformers, leading to widespread outages.
    • Equipment Failures: Aging infrastructure and mechanical issues can result in unexpected power interruptions.
    • Planned Maintenance: Oncor occasionally schedules maintenance activities to ensure the reliability of its systems, which may cause temporary outages.
    • Vegetation Interference: Overgrown trees and branches can disrupt power lines, especially during windy conditions.

    Impact of Oncor Energy Outages

    Effects on Residential Customers

    Oncor energy outages can have a significant impact on residential customers. Without electricity, essential appliances such as refrigerators, air conditioners, and lighting systems become non-functional. This can lead to spoiled food, discomfort, and safety concerns, particularly during extreme weather conditions.

    Impact on Businesses

    Businesses rely heavily on a stable power supply to operate efficiently. Oncor energy outages can result in lost productivity, damaged equipment, and financial losses. Small businesses, in particular, may struggle to recover from extended power interruptions. Having a contingency plan in place can help mitigate these effects.

    • Invest in a backup power source, such as a generator or uninterruptible power supply (UPS).
    • Create an emergency kit containing essentials like flashlights, batteries, and non-perishable food.
    • Stay informed by signing up for Oncor's outage alerts and monitoring local news updates.
    • Regularly maintain your home's electrical systems to prevent avoidable issues.

    Solutions for Oncor Energy Outages

    Investing in Smart Grid Technology

    Smart grid technology can significantly enhance Oncor's ability to detect and respond to outages. By integrating advanced sensors and communication systems, Oncor can pinpoint the source of disruptions more efficiently and restore power faster. This technology also enables customers to monitor their energy usage and identify potential issues before they escalate.

    Enhancing Infrastructure

    Upgrading and maintaining Oncor's infrastructure is essential for reducing the frequency and duration of outages. This includes replacing aging equipment, reinforcing power lines, and implementing vegetation management programs. By investing in these improvements, Oncor can ensure a more reliable and resilient energy network.

    Legal and Regulatory Framework

    Compliance with State Regulations

    Oncor operates under the regulatory oversight of the Public Utility Commission of Texas (PUC). This ensures that the company adheres to strict standards for safety, reliability, and customer service. The PUC regularly reviews Oncor's performance and enforces penalties for non-compliance, safeguarding the interests of consumers.

    Customer Rights and Protections

    Customers have certain rights and protections when it comes to Oncor energy outages. These include the right to receive timely and accurate information about disruptions, as well as the ability to file complaints with the PUC if issues are not resolved satisfactorily. Understanding these rights empowers customers to advocate for better service.
